以太坊2.0阶段0简化,同时存款合约等待BLS冻结

eth2.0的Danny Ryan认为,以太坊开发人员似乎在最后一刻对以太坊2.0进行了一些更改,将分片从1024减少到了64,同时将阶段0的“干净状态”“设计为阶段1之上”。协调员。

Ryan最近“根据围绕替代的第1阶段提案的讨论”对代码进行了一些更改,以便从“第0阶段完全删除Shard和Crosslink的概念”。

他指的是以太坊联合创始人Vitalik Buterin的提议,他称其为“根本替代方案”,消除了许多复杂性,“导致ETH2能够更早使用,风险更低。”

该提案删除了“持久分片链”的概念。相反,每个分片块都直接是交叉链接。提案人提议,交链委员会批准,完成。”

所有这些使测试网更容易启动,因为它们将删除所有分片和交叉链接机制,将其留在第一阶段。

Buterin说:“让我们放弃'crosslink'这个词,因为我们不是'链接'到一个碎片链,而直接使用'shard block'这个词。”

该提案基本上将“碎片”通过“一种途径”链接起来,通过该途径,任何碎片的N-1个插槽都知道所有碎片的N个时隙。因此,我们现在有了一流的单插槽跨碎片通信(通过Merkle收据)…

信标块N + 1已发布,其中包括所有分片的这些证明。 N + 1块的状态转换功能处理这些证明,并更新所有分片的“最新状态”。

用通俗易懂的语言,从我们的理解中,您不必通过必须相互进行“对话”的不同分片“Cosmos”,而是通过信标发送所有内容,基本上完成了所有“对话”。

这使信标本身成为了瓶颈,但是显然“收据”压缩了数据,因此它远没有节点当前的瓶颈。

这最后一刻的变化是因为,即使您将eth在一个分片到另一个分片之间转移,一个分片“ Universe”与另一个对话也需要相当长的时间。

大概他们还不太想知道如何减少这种时间需求,因此他们在阶段1和阶段2方面进行了相当大的更改。

在第0阶段方面,他们正在删除东西,因此应该更容易解决,但这听起来似乎还有很多事情要经过,与Sigma Prime的eth2.0客户Lighthouse的Age Manning进行测试网合作之后,上个月说:

“我们正在调试和试验客户端之间的互操作性。这有很多阶段。”

我们今天还不能及时发布更新。明天有一个eth2.0电话,预计会有开发更新,当然还有另一方面是启动该过程的存放合约。

它使用BLS签名,这是新的加密货币技术,尚待考虑草案的情况下进行标准化处理。

似乎负责加密货币方面的贾斯汀·德雷克(Justin Drake)以及其他eth开发人员已经决定,在使用BLS同意标准的不同项目之间达成某种协议,而不必等待委员会与Dfinity的合作。开发人员似乎在努力工作。 PegaSys的Ben Edgington告诉Trustnodes:

“我不是决策者,但已经与有关各方进行了交谈。 (1)新的BLS规范已经稳定了一段时间,并且认为不太可能进一步改变。 (2)很快(几周)采用此方法的区块链将同意将其冻结。请注意,正式标准化将花费更长的时间,但是我们对此并不担心。 (3)将实现基于新方法对存款数据进行签名的工具。 (4)存款合约将生效。我希望这是最后一步,但那只是推测。我不认为需要更长的时间。”

此外,其中一个测试网清单似乎至少需要对它的某些组件进行更多的工作,因为现在阶段1将于1月份退出,这是非常不可能的。

三月也可能是一个乐观的估计,但是看起来这种简化可能正在帮助进行大量工作。然而,似乎还有很多变化,希望明天能更加明确。

资讯来源:由0x资讯编译自TRUSTNODES。版权归作者所有,未经许可,不得转载
提示:投资有风险,入市需谨慎,本资讯不作为投资理财建议。请理性投资,切实提高风险防范意识;如有发现的违法犯罪线索,可积极向有关部门举报反映。
你可能还喜欢